web-dev-qa-db-ja.com

Ubuntu 18.04 LTSでWiFiがランダムに切断される

今週にUbuntu 18.04 LTSをインストールしましたが、Wi-Fi接続に問題があります。 WiFi接続は5〜10分ごとに自動的に切断されますが、Wi-Fi信号は引き続き良好です。
検索を行って、Ubuntuの古いバージョンの回答を見つけて試してみましたが、問題は解決しませんでした。
ワイヤレスアダプタの情報は次のとおりです。

description: Wireless interface
       product: QCA9565 / AR9565 Wireless Network Adapter
       vendor: Qualcomm Atheros
       physical id: 0
       bus info: pci@0000:02:00.0
       logical name: wlp2s0
       version: 01
       serial: a4:db:30:03:32:8c
       width: 64 bits
       clock: 33MHz
       capabilities: pm msi pciexpress bus_master cap_list rom ethernet physical wireless
       configuration: broadcast=yes driver=ath9k driverversion=4.15.0-20-generic firmware=N/A ip=10.0.138.105 latency=0 link=yes multicast=yes wireless=IEEE 802.11
       resources: irq:18 memory:f0600000-f067ffff memory:f0680000-f068ffff
42

/etc/NetworkManager/conf.d/default-wifi-powersave-on.confを開いて変更して、wifiの電源管理を無効にしてみてください

wifi.powersave = 3

wifi.powersave = 2

デフォルト値である0に設定しないでください。 nm-setting-wireless.h から:

/**
 * NMSettingWirelessPowersave:
 * @NM_SETTING_WIRELESS_POWERSAVE_DEFAULT: use the default value
 * @NM_SETTING_WIRELESS_POWERSAVE_IGNORE: don't touch existing setting
 * @NM_SETTING_WIRELESS_POWERSAVE_DISABLE: disable powersave
 * @NM_SETTING_WIRELESS_POWERSAVE_ENABLE: enable powersave
 *
 * These flags indicate whether wireless powersave must be enabled.
 **/
typedef enum {
    NM_SETTING_WIRELESS_POWERSAVE_DEFAULT       = 0,
    NM_SETTING_WIRELESS_POWERSAVE_IGNORE        = 1,
    NM_SETTING_WIRELESS_POWERSAVE_DISABLE       = 2,
    NM_SETTING_WIRELESS_POWERSAVE_ENABLE        = 3,
    _NM_SETTING_WIRELESS_POWERSAVE_NUM, /*< skip >*/
    NM_SETTING_WIRELESS_POWERSAVE_LAST          =  _NM_SETTING_WIRELESS_POWERSAVE_NUM - 1, /*< skip >*/
} NMSettingWirelessPowersave;
9
qwr

コンピューターとルーター間の接続の設定でIPV6をオフにしようとする可能性があります。 UbuntuにはIPV6で問題が発生することがあります。ほとんどの古いルーターはまだIPV4を使用しています。これは私の古いPocket wifiで機能しました(新しいWi-Fiでは問題ありません)。使用している18.04のバージョンを正確に指定していないため、これ以上のガイドはできません。

Xubuntu 16.04があり、通知でネットワーク接続に移動し、[接続の編集]を開き、ルーターへの接続を見つけて編集します。 IPV6を無視に設定します。この後、接続は切断されませんでした。

3
Jan Johansson

私はバイオニックでも同じ問題を抱えていました。まず、Qualcomm Atheros QCA6174 802.11acワイヤレスネットワークアダプターに関連していると思いましたが、更新後も信号は変動し続けました。

Gnomeのネットワークマネージャーに関連しているようです。 WICDに切り替えた後、wi fiはもう不安定ではありません(ほぼ4か月前)。 [編集:2019年5月28日現在、まだ問題はありません]この修正を適用するためのいくつかの手順は次のとおりです。

ターミナルを開き、次のコマンドを実行します:

まず、WICDをインストールします。

 Sudo apt install wicd-gtk

次に、NetworkManagerをアンインストールします。

Sudo apt remove network-manager-gnome network-manager

すべてが機能していることを確認した後(再起動後にこれを確認するのが最善です)、NetworkManagerの構成ファイルを削除できます。

Sudo dpkg --purge network-manager-gnome network-manager

(ソース https://help.ubuntu.com/community/WICD

私の設定は少し異なるかもしれませんが、おそらく私の答えも役立ちます...

私のセットアップは次のとおりです。

laptop <-> wifi (bridge mode) <-> router <-> internet
  • ラップトップはUbuntu 18.04.2です。
  • WiFiブリッジはTP-Link TL-WR940Nです。
  • ルーターはArris 703Aです。

接続が時々ドロップするという同じ問題がありました。すべてのサービスがArrisルーターで実行されており、TP-LinkとArrisの間の接続が振動するため、TP-Linkに接続されているすべてのものがネットワーク接続がないと「考えている」ので、それが起こっていたと思います落とした。

接続をより安定させるために働いた唯一のことは、DHCPを使用する代わりに、静的IPアドレス、ゲートウェイ、およびDNSサーバーをセットアップすることでした。

私はまだ発振しますが、少なくとも無線LANは落ちません。リクエストを完了するのに少し時間がかかることがあります。

まあ、それは非常に簡単な答えですが、それが誰かに役立つことを願っています。

1

これが私の無線LANが不安定になり、常に切断された理由ですが、私の無線LANはCentrino(Atherosではありません):IPV6を無効にします。

次の行をファイルに追加します/etc/sysctl.conf

net.ipv6.conf.all.disable_ipv6 = 1
net.ipv6.conf.default.disable_ipv6 = 1
net.ipv6.conf.lo.disable_ipv6 = 1

リブート。

1
desgua

私の場合、ルーターの周波数を5 GHzから2.4 GHzに変更すると、問題が大幅に解決しました。

0
Pankaj Joshi